Team,

Welcome aboard. The Hallwyn Audio Guide app pulls exhibit tracks from our Murmura content API. Contractors work against the staging environment only — production sync is handled by our side. Track metadata must include gallery code, language, and duration; uploads missing any field are rejected silently, so check the validation endpoint first. Offline bundles rebuild nightly at 02:00, so expect a delay before new tracks appear on test devices. Use the staging bearer token below for all requests.

session JWT of yawep-yawep = eyJhbGciOiJIUzI1NiIsInR5cCI6IkpXVCJ9.eyJzdWIiOiI3pWF3_In0.aXYsHiog

Runbook — Regional Chess Final, Score Sheets

Quick one for you: the signed score sheets from the Pellingford Open final are boxed and waiting at the Tannery Hall front desk. They're originals, so no photocopy detours this time — arbiters need them intact for ratings. One flat box, light, but keep it dry. Driver should grab it before the hall closes at six. The courier hand-over detail is noted just below.

handover note for bajog-tawig: the lamion quenael courier leaves the wendor ledger at gate 1289 under passcode 760784

TURN-208: Gatevale turnstile counters at the Merrow Field pilot double-count when a rotation reverses mid-cycle. Attendance totals drift roughly 2% high per event. The debounce window fix is implemented, reviewed by Ilsa, and soak-tested across two simulated match days without drift. Ready for your cut; the candidate build is identified below.

trace token, tagag-tafog: htk6_5ed18c

## Changelog — Thumbla v4.2.0

Default concurrency for the thumbnail generation queue has changed from 4 to 8 workers, and retry backoff now starts at 2s instead of 500ms. If the queue depth alarms fire after rollout, check worker memory first before scaling. The new effective defaults are as follows.

deployment values, taweg-bajop:
[fenvan]
port = 5672
team = holmir
host = fenvan.orvexio.example
region = lower-1
access_code = ac_b98bc6
timeout_ms = 1500